Cheese Toast by my mother: White bread was 4 long loafs for $1, in Kentucky, in 1953, my Dad was pastor of a very small Baptist Church, in Dewitt, KY. His pay was 30 per month, but once a month they had a "pounding for the pastor" and each person brought a pound or more of something. The US government gave out long loafs of CHEESE. We always got one per month, and sometimes more. 

Recipe. Take out your cookie sheet, line it with slices of white bread until full, slice a slice of the loaf and lay on the bread and bake it in the oven until the edges are Krispy. The bottom will be soft, the top gooey and Krispy..

You can choose any bread, any cheese, slice it, dice it, shred it and place on your fav bread and put in toaster oven. I am impatient with baking so STAND and WATCH it while it is on BROIL....  trust me, IT WILL turn black or even burst into flames OR set off the smoke alarm IF NOT WATCHED......😁😁😁

✅  Water 12 gallons and 45 bottles, a few in each room in case one room has blown windows or roof gone

  ✅ cash ✅ photos of every thing in the house taken and in the cloud  ✅ Beaus Rabies/shots record in my phone. He went to vet yesterday, yes we went with him. Vet Tech said get a copy of your shots, if you go anywhere during or after storm, they will want to see it.

✅important papers in plastic bags inside cooler, duct taped so it will float and survive.

✅RX inside small cooler, for dog and both humans, name, address and phone number, 

✅ Card made with 5 MOST important passwords 

✅ phones charged, iPad, Chromebook charged, 3 battery packs charged, I used one of the packs during Helene power outage to run a USB lamp


Two new lanterns, with 6 settings, Red Steady, Red Flashes (hope I don't need those), high/low flash light and high/low as lantern with string to hang on arm, yes, I played with them. One can charge while using other one, since it said DO NOT use while charging.
